Ok folks, what would be the top 24 songs you would want to see on a Hallowe'en Album?
My Picks (in no particular order) 1. Werewolves of London - Warren Zevon 2. Thriller - Micheal Jackson 3. Ghost Busters - Ray Parker Jr. 4. Dinner with Drac - John Zacherle 5. Evil Woman - ELO 6. Monster Mash - Bobby Boris Picket & the Crypt Kickers 7. Witchy Woman - The Eagles 8. The Time Warp - Rocky Horror Picture Show Cast 9. Devil Went Down to Georgia - Charlie Daniels Band 10. I Put a Spell On You - the Animals 11. X-Files dance remix 12. Bat Out of Hell - Meatloaf 13. Bad Moon Rising - CCR 14. Strange Animal - Gowan 15. Black Magic Woman - Santana 16. Witch Doctor - David Seville 17. Scary Monsters - David Bowie 18. Lil’ Red Riding Hood – Sam the Sham and the Pharaohs 19. Super Freak - Rick James 20. Abracadabra – Steve Miller Band 21. Don’t Fear the Reaper – Blue Oyster Cult 22. Superstition - Stevie Wonder 23. Devil with a Blue Dress On – Mitch Ryder 24. Changes - David Bowie
